Story Structure — 4 Plot Phases

The Drunken Revolt

Kovač's public outburst triggers an organizational review of his dissent. The meeting exposes deep ideological fractures over press freedom and editorial control.

Editorial Ascension

Tomac assumes leadership and attempts to co-opt Kovač's talent. Kovač's steadfast refusal strains his professional standing and personal life.

Institutional Pressure

Political shifts in the Mikros strike prompt Tomac to demand compromised reporting. Kovač's marital collapse mirrors his professional isolation.

Censored Truth

Kovač's tribute to a fallen colleague is mutilated by the press apparatus. The final publication underscores the suffocating grip of systemic control.
